你查询的IP:[114.80.126.181]  地理位置:中国–上海–上海电信/IDC机房

最新查询59.192.112.235 58.128.42.22 123.244.44.153 118.132.25.187 123.137.45.23 125.112.252.214 124.14.235.254 134.196.71.107 121.201.197.241 114.80.126.181 123.101.253.103 203.152.64.70 123.112.98.76 124.72.210.254 122.193.64.176 119.75.208.70 121.201.214.242 120.24.225.235 203.90.90.174 203.184.80.139 202.4.128.158 203.18.50.187 203.91.120.89 210.28.146.30 124.224.246.226 123.108.128.249 202.127.216.149 60.194.225.26 120.90.8.208 116.252.185.52 116.254.128.164